Transaction 38e63f83c48e1290bb71ef42ebc2ea9ba4e01a84a0c5f24d5d24966ead604035
1 Input
2 Outputs
- 38e63f83c48e1290bb71ef42ebc2ea9ba4e01a84a0c5f24d5d24966ead604035:0
- 38e63f83c48e1290bb71ef42ebc2ea9ba4e01a84a0c5f24d5d24966ead604035:1
value 15176595
address 381J9C3Ug3uJ2CcWQxAGVeoFxDRn5JN62p
value 1000000
address 139padC2f3GJx4eibJPGQg4r3vgHKn3cNw